Although some things like family history can’t be changed, certain modifications in lifestyle have been shown to decrease chances of breast cancer.  Here are some easy tips to lower your risk from The Mayo Clinic:

Limit alcohol intake – Based on research done between the link to alcohol consumption and breast cancer, the general recommendation is to limit yourself to limit yourself to less than 1 drink a day.

Don’t smoke – There is increasing evidence that suggest that there is a link between smoking and breast cancer, particularly among peri-menopausal women.

Maintain a healthy weight – Obesity can increase your risk for breast cancer, particularly if it happens after menopause. Eating a healthy diet, like a Mediterranean diet supplemented, has been shown to help reduce the risk of breast cancer.

Stay physically active – Exercise helps maintain a healthy weight which, in turn, decreases your risk for breast cancer.


NBCF offers an informative video series called “Beyond the Shock”.  This is a free, comprehensive, online guide to understanding breast cancer. It is a resource for women who have been diagnosed with breast cancer, a place for loved ones to gain a better understanding of the disease, and a tool for doctors to share information.The first one is included below and the series continues on NBCF site.
